Марлин (DRM)
![]() | В этой статье есть несколько проблем. Пожалуйста, помогите улучшить его или обсудите эти проблемы на странице обсуждения . ( Узнайте, как и когда удалять эти шаблонные сообщения ) |
Marlin — это платформа DRM , созданная инициативой сообщества открытых стандартов под названием Marlin Developer Community (MDC). [1] MDC разрабатывает необходимые технологии, партнеров и услуги для создания совместимых служб распространения цифрового контента.
Технология Marlin предоставляет потребителям возможность управлять взаимоотношениями между устройствами, сетевыми службами и цифровым контентом. С помощью Marlin поставщики услуг и маркеры устройств могут создавать и поддерживать контент-сервисы в открытых сетях.
История
[ редактировать ]MDC была образована в 2005 году пятью компаниями — Intertrust , Panasonic , Philips , Samsung и Sony . MDC выпустила первый набор спецификаций в мае 2006 года. [2] Основатели Marlin также сформировали Организацию доверительного управления Marlin (MTMO), которая действует как нейтральная организация по доверительному управлению и лицензированию. MTMO начал коммерческую деятельность в январе 2007 года. [3]
Технология
[ редактировать ]Marlin создавался с конкретными дизайнерскими целями. Во-первых, Marlin позволяет потребительским устройствам импортировать контент из нескольких независимых сервисов и обеспечивать одноранговое взаимодействие. Во-вторых, Marlin основан на архитектуре управления правами общего назначения. Спецификации Marlin определяют возможности и архитектуру, обеспечивающие взаимодействие устройств и сервисов.
Большинство реализаций Marlin включают базовую спецификацию системы, которая определяет базовые компоненты, протоколы и модель потребительского домена, которые обеспечивают взаимодействие между устройствами и сервисами с поддержкой Marlin. Эта спецификация основана на эталонных технологиях Octopus и NEMO, которые были адаптированы для однорангового взаимодействия устройств.
общего назначения Управление правами в Marlin основано на Octopus, который представляет собой архитектуру DRM . [4] В центре системы Octopus находится механизм отношений на основе графов. В Marlin объекты узлов Octopus используются для представления системных объектов (таких как пользователи и устройства), а связи между узлами представляют отношения. Система узлов и ссылок управляет тем, где, как и когда контент может использоваться в системе Marlin. Octopus работает на различных платформах, не зависит от медиаформата и криптографии.
NEMO — это аббревиатура от «Сетевая среда для оркестровки мультимедиа». [5] Он обеспечивает основанную на услугах структуру для доверенных соединений между различными компонентами системы Marlin DRM. Основываясь на стандартах веб-сервисов, NEMO определяет сервисные интерфейсы, политики доступа к сервисам и поддержку доверительных отношений между распределенными объектами, которые играют четко определенные и сертифицированные роли. Структура NEMO позволяет компонентам Marlin доставлять защищенные сообщения и обмениваться ими между аутентифицированными и авторизованными объектами. Сервисы, поддерживаемые NEMO, могут работать вместе с другими медиасервисами для конкретных приложений, которые не обязаны быть совместимыми с NEMO.
Продукты
[ редактировать ]Основные продукты для внедрения Marlin включают в себя:
- ExpressPlay: ExpressPlay — это хостинговая услуга, предоставляемая Intertrust и представленная в мае 2013 года. [6] Он в первую очередь предназначен для интеграции защиты контента Marlin для служб распространения контента через Интернет. ExpressPlay предоставляет размещенный серверный компонент Marlin для управления ключами Marlin и клиентский SDK для iOS и Android. . [7]
- Широкополосный сервер Bluewhale Marlin: Широкополосный сервер Bluewhale Marlin представляет собой настраиваемую реализацию сервера Marlin, обеспечивающую поддержку, необходимую для безопасной доставки цифрового контента клиентам Marlin. Чтобы подготовить соответствующую информацию, запрашиваемую клиентами, сервер Bluewhale интегрируется с внутренней бизнес-логикой поставщика услуг, используя интерфейс на основе XML. Он преобразует бизнес-логику в объекты прав Marlin, например, создавая и управляя лицензиями и регистрациями пользователей.
- Bento4 Packager: Bento4 Packager — это программный инструмент для упаковки и анализа контента, который работает с клиентами Marlin. Этот инструмент упаковывает, шифрует и защищает файлы содержимого на стороне сервера. На стороне клиента инструмент обеспечивает расшифровку и анализ контента.
- Sushi Marlin Client SDK: Sushi Marlin Client SDK используется для создания функций DRM на стороне клиента. Этот SDK предоставляет основные компоненты Marlin, необходимые для определения условий лицензии и контроля доступа к защищенному контенту. Его можно адаптировать для использования в аппаратных устройствах, а приложения воспроизведения мультимедиа и доступа к услугам также могут использовать его для обеспечения функциональности DRM. По состоянию на май 2013 года Intertrust больше не предоставляет SDK Sushi Marlin Client.
Партнеры
[ редактировать ]В октябре 2008 года MDC объявил о создании Партнерской программы Marlin (MPP), в первоначальном запуске которой будут участвовать более 25 компаний. [8] По состоянию на январь 2014 года на сайте Marlin было зарегистрировано 42 компании-партнера. [9]
Партнеры-члены идентифицируют, разрабатывают и предоставляют различные технические компоненты и услуги по интеграции, создавая рынок решений Marlin. Сетевые операторы, поставщики услуг, производители устройств и другие компании, внедряющие продукты и услуги на базе Marlin, могут работать с компаниями-членами MPP.
Трастовые услуги
[ редактировать ]Технология основана на открытых стандартах, но безопасностью системы управляет независимая организация — MTMO. MTMO поддерживает целостность и безопасность системы посредством своих служб управления ключами.
Развертывание
[ редактировать ]Marlin коммерчески используется по всему миру на различных устройствах и сервисах.
Marlin включен в национальный стандарт IPTV в Японии и был развернут Actvila, веб-порталом телевидения, запущенным в 2007 году. Сервисный портал Actvila, созданный партнерами Hitachi, Panasonic, Sharp, Sony и Toshiba, включал в себя рулон -нет телевизоров с доступом в Интернет.
Sony использует Marlin в сети PlayStation Network, позволяя пользователям службы загрузки видео делиться купленным или арендованным контентом на системах PS3, PS4 и PSP.
Телевизоры и проигрыватели Blu-ray , поддерживающие Philips Net TV [10] услуга.
Сервис онлайн-видео Tencent.
Следующие организации по стандартизации указали использование Marlin в своих спецификациях:
- UltraViolet — стандарт системы аутентификации цифровых прав и облачной системы распространения из экосистемы цифрового развлекательного контента.
- Открытый форум IPTV
Следующие национальные инициативы выбрали Марлин:
- Итальянская платформа услуг интернет-телевидения, разработанная Tivu. [11] консорциум
- YouView — открытая интернет-платформа для Соединенного Королевства.
- Характеристики TNT . 2.0 с HD-форума Франции
Другие потребительские медиа-сервисы, такие как iQIYI, принадлежащий Baidu. [12] и ППТВ [13] в Китае получили лицензию Marlin.
Ссылки
[ редактировать ]- ^ «Marlin — платформа обмена контентом для потребительских устройств и мультимедийных сервисов» . Марлин-сообщество.com. Архивировано из оригинала 2 октября 2012 г. Проверено 28 сентября 2012 г.
- ^ «Основатели Marlin публикуют технические характеристики | Marlin — платформа обмена контентом для потребительских устройств и мультимедийных услуг» . Архивировано из оригинала 22 февраля 2014 г. Проверено 4 февраля 2014 г.
- ^ «Организация доверительного управления Marlin теперь открыта | Marlin — платформа обмена контентом для потребительских устройств и мультимедийных услуг» . Архивировано из оригинала 22 февраля 2014 г. Проверено 4 февраля 2014 г.
- ^ «Осьминог: набор инструментов для механизмов DRM | Intertrust» . www.intertrust.com . Архивировано из оригинала 21 августа 2010 г.
- ^ «НЕМО | Интертраст» . www.intertrust.com . Архивировано из оригинала 21 августа 2010 г.
- ^ «Intertrust объявляет об облачной защите контента ExpressPlay™ с возможностью самообслуживания | Intertrust» . www.intertrust.com . Архивировано из оригинала 27 июня 2013 г.
- ^ «Интертраст ЭкспрессПлей» . ЭкспрессПлей . Архивировано из оригинала 10 февраля 2014 г. Проверено 31 января 2014 г.
- ^ «Лидеры технологий объявляют о партнерской программе Marlin | Marlin — платформа обмена контентом для потребительских устройств и мультимедийных услуг» . Архивировано из оригинала 22 февраля 2014 г. Проверено 4 февраля 2014 г.
- ^ «О партнерах | Marlin — платформа обмена контентом для потребительских устройств и мультимедийных сервисов» . Архивировано из оригинала 22 февраля 2014 г. Проверено 4 февраля 2014 г.
- ^ «Филипс» . Филипс. Архивировано из оригинала 6 октября 2012 г. Проверено 28 сентября 2012 г.
- ^ «Телевидение – Свобода просмотра» . Тиву.тв. Архивировано из оригинала 23 сентября 2012 г. Проверено 28 сентября 2012 г.
- ^ «iQIYI компании Baidu лицензирует решение Intertrust ExpressPlay Marlin DRM | Intertrust» . www.intertrust.com . Архивировано из оригинала 11 сентября 2013 г.
- ^ «Китайский онлайн-видеоплеер PPTV лицензирует систему защиты контента Intertrust ExpressPlay | Intertrust» . www.intertrust.com . Архивировано из оригинала 19 февраля 2014 г.